#071077 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#071077 is composed of 2.7% red, 6.3%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 24.7%. #071077 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e20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#071077 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#071077 has RGB values of R:7, G:16,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 462967.

Shades and Tints of #071077
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#071077
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3d42 is the less saturated color, while #020c7c is the most saturated one.
